Browser Gaming: The Democratization of Interactive Entertainment

The advent of HTML5 and advancements in WebGL have revolutionized how developers approach browser-based games. According to industry reports, the browser gaming segment is projected to reach a global revenue of approximately $1.8 billion by 2025, exemplifying a steady CAGR of around 12% since 2020 (Gaming Industry Forecast, 2023). These numbers are driven by factors such as increased device compatibility, improved latency, and a shift towards instant-access gaming experiences.

Historically, browser games were associated with simplistic graphics and limited gameplay. However, contemporary titles leverage sophisticated graphics, multiplayer functionality, and seamless performance—leading to a paradigm where players can indulge in complex, high-quality gaming experiences directly within their web browsers.

The Role of Cloud Gaming and Instant Play Platforms

Cloud gaming services have pushed the boundaries further, allowing players to engage with high-fidelity content on modest devices. These platforms epitomize the ‘instant play’ ethos—minimizing wait times and barrier to entry. Leading the charge, some developers have integrated browser-based interfaces with cloud streaming, thus expanding audience reach and retention.
